Financial District · Advanced diagnostics & longevity

A single-day diagnostics program in the Financial District bundling twenty or more assessments (whole-body MRI, VO2 max, genetic testing and DEXA) with a results consultation delivered by a physician, a registered dietitian and an exercise physiologist.

Pricing and payment model

What the clinic publishes

Core Membership$7,500 · first year20+ assessments in a single-day visit including whole-body MRI, VO2 max, genetic testing and DEXA, plus a results consultation with the medical team, a registered dietitian and an exercise physiologist. First-year price; subsequent-year pricing varies.
Black Membership$15,000 · first year30+ assessments adding CT coronary angiography, multi-cancer early detection and multi-modal brain health, plus at-home sleep and glucose monitoring, mid-year blood work and clinical check-ins.
Reservation deposit$500 · depositRequired to reserve your visit.

Every figure above carries the billing basis the clinic published with it. Prices reflect clinic-published information and may change. Confirm inclusions and current fees directly with the clinic.

Bring this list

Questions worth asking this clinic

Drawn from what the clinic’s own materials leave open. Useful for a first call or consult.

What does year two cost after the first-year membership price?
Is the $500 deposit applied to the membership price or additional to it?
Which physician delivers my results consultation, and what are they certified in?
